Merge branch 'trunk' into branch-feature-AMBARI-12556
Project: http://git-wip-us.apache.org/repos/asf/ambari/repo Commit: http://git-wip-us.apache.org/repos/asf/ambari/commit/353cd9df Tree: http://git-wip-us.apache.org/repos/asf/ambari/tree/353cd9df Diff: http://git-wip-us.apache.org/repos/asf/ambari/diff/353cd9df Branch: refs/heads/trunk Commit: 353cd9dfd0132356305902fa0d58980eb4749a84 Parents: 4527aa1 9d38b66 Author: Jonathan Hurley <jhur...@hortonworks.com> Authored: Mon Mar 6 13:36:01 2017 -0500 Committer: Jonathan Hurley <jhur...@hortonworks.com> Committed: Mon Mar 6 13:36:01 2017 -0500 ---------------------------------------------------------------------- .../resources/ui/admin-web/app/styles/main.css | 38 +- .../app/views/ambariViews/listTable.html | 2 +- .../app/views/ambariViews/listUrls.html | 2 +- .../metrics/loadsimulator/LoadRunner.java | 13 +- .../loadsimulator/MetricsLoadSimulator.java | 2 + .../metrics/loadsimulator/data/AppID.java | 4 +- .../timeline/TimelineMetricConfiguration.java | 3 + .../metrics/timeline/TimelineMetricsFilter.java | 31 +- .../main/resources/metrics_def/AMS-HBASE.dat | 257 +++- .../src/main/resources/metrics_def/DATANODE.dat | 262 ++-- .../resources/metrics_def/FLUME_HANDLER.dat | 57 +- .../resources/metrics_def/HIVEMETASTORE.dat | 181 +++ .../main/resources/metrics_def/HIVESERVER2.dat | 117 ++ .../src/main/resources/metrics_def/HOST.dat | 31 + .../src/main/resources/metrics_def/NAMENODE.dat | 335 ++++- .../main/resources/metrics_def/NODEMANAGER.dat | 16 + .../resources/metrics_def/RESOURCEMANAGER.dat | 247 ++-- .../jmetertest/AMSJMeterLoadTest.java | 34 +- .../timeline/TimelineMetricsFilterTest.java | 70 + .../src/test/resources/loadsimulator/README | 2 +- .../loadsimulator/ams-jmeter.properties | 8 +- .../resources/test_data/metric_whitelist.dat | 2 + .../internal/AbstractProviderModule.java | 21 +- .../dispatchers/AlertScriptDispatcher.java | 7 +- .../services/AlertNoticeDispatchService.java | 8 + .../server/upgrade/UpgradeCatalog250.java | 57 + .../package/files/service-metrics/FLUME.txt | 14 +- .../package/files/service-metrics/HDFS.txt | 157 ++- .../package/files/service-metrics/HIVE.txt | 181 +++ .../package/files/service-metrics/HOST.txt | 36 +- .../package/files/service-metrics/KAFKA.txt | 1244 +++++++++++++++--- .../0.9.2/configuration/druid-superset-env.xml | 4 +- .../0.5.0.2.1/configuration/falcon-env.xml | 2 +- .../HBASE/0.96.0.2.0/alerts.json | 4 +- .../2.1.0.2.0/package/scripts/hdfs_rebalance.py | 32 +- .../HDFS/2.1.0.2.0/package/scripts/namenode.py | 14 +- .../3.0.0.3.0/package/scripts/hdfs_rebalance.py | 28 +- .../HDFS/3.0.0.3.0/package/scripts/namenode.py | 14 +- .../HIVE/0.12.0.2.0/configuration/hive-env.xml | 2 +- .../package/scripts/hive_interactive.py | 7 + .../SQOOP/1.4.4.2.0/configuration/sqoop-env.xml | 2 +- .../STORM/0.10.0/configuration/storm-env.xml | 2 +- .../STORM/0.9.1/package/scripts/params_linux.py | 2 + .../STORM/0.9.1/package/scripts/storm.py | 7 + .../YARN/2.1.0.2.0/configuration/yarn-site.xml | 2 +- .../0.6.0.2.5/configuration/zeppelin-env.xml | 2 +- .../0.6.0.2.5/package/scripts/master.py | 36 +- .../0.6.0.2.5/package/scripts/params.py | 8 + .../services/YARN/configuration/yarn-site.xml | 2 +- .../services/YARN/configuration/yarn-site.xml | 2 +- .../services/YARN/configuration/yarn-site.xml | 2 +- .../stacks/HDP/2.3/upgrades/config-upgrade.xml | 5 + .../HDP/2.3/upgrades/nonrolling-upgrade-2.6.xml | 6 + .../stacks/HDP/2.3/upgrades/upgrade-2.6.xml | 1 + .../stacks/HDP/2.4/upgrades/config-upgrade.xml | 5 + .../HDP/2.4/upgrades/nonrolling-upgrade-2.6.xml | 6 + .../stacks/HDP/2.4/upgrades/upgrade-2.6.xml | 1 + .../configuration/application-properties.xml | 42 + .../services/HIVE/configuration/hive-log4j2.xml | 2 +- .../HIVE/configuration/llap-cli-log4j2.xml | 2 +- .../stacks/HDP/2.5/upgrades/config-upgrade.xml | 10 + .../HDP/2.5/upgrades/nonrolling-upgrade-2.5.xml | 6 + .../HDP/2.5/upgrades/nonrolling-upgrade-2.6.xml | 12 + .../stacks/HDP/2.5/upgrades/upgrade-2.5.xml | 6 + .../stacks/HDP/2.5/upgrades/upgrade-2.6.xml | 2 + .../configuration/application-properties.xml | 3 +- .../HIVE/configuration/tez-interactive-site.xml | 8 + .../services/YARN/configuration/yarn-site.xml | 28 + .../internal/JMXHostProviderTest.java | 33 + .../dispatchers/AlertScriptDispatcherTest.java | 28 +- .../server/upgrade/UpgradeCatalog250Test.java | 1077 ++++++++------- .../python/stacks/2.0.6/HDFS/test_namenode.py | 19 +- .../stacks/2.0.6/common/test_stack_advisor.py | 8 +- .../python/stacks/2.1/STORM/test_storm_base.py | 12 + .../stacks/2.2/common/test_stack_advisor.py | 26 +- .../stacks/2.5/HIVE/test_hive_server_int.py | 15 +- .../stacks/2.5/ZEPPELIN/test_zeppelin_master.py | 26 +- .../2.5/configs/hsi_default_for_restart.json | 1 + ambari-web/app/assets/test/tests.js | 1 + ambari-web/app/routes/main.js | 78 ++ ambari-web/app/routes/view.js | 5 + ambari-web/app/routes/views.js | 7 + ambari-web/app/styles/common.less | 4 +- ambari-web/app/styles/log_file_search.less | 3 - ambari-web/app/templates/application.hbs | 8 +- ambari-web/app/templates/common/breadcrumbs.hbs | 24 + .../templates/common/host_progress_popup.hbs | 8 +- ambari-web/app/views.js | 1 + ambari-web/app/views/application.js | 106 +- ambari-web/app/views/common/breadcrumbs_view.js | 190 +++ .../common/host_progress_popup_body_view.js | 19 +- ambari-web/app/views/common/modal_popup.js | 11 +- .../test/controllers/main/service/item_test.js | 19 +- .../test/views/common/breadcrumbs_view_test.js | 37 + .../ui/app/components/visual-explain.js | 11 +- .../resources/ui/app/routes/queries/query.js | 1 + .../ui/app/utils/hive-explainer/fallback.js | 3 +- .../ui/app/utils/hive-explainer/index.js | 5 +- .../ui/app/utils/hive-explainer/processor.js | 1 - .../ui/app/utils/hive-explainer/renderer.js | 18 +- .../ui/app/utils/hive-explainer/transformer.js | 75 +- .../ui/app/components/bundle-config.js | 17 - .../resources/ui/app/components/coord-config.js | 17 - .../ui/app/components/flow-designer.js | 13 - .../resources/ui/app/components/job-config.js | 2 - .../main/resources/ui/app/components/save-wf.js | 2 - .../app/templates/components/bundle-config.hbs | 11 +- .../app/templates/components/coord-config.hbs | 11 +- .../app/templates/components/flow-designer.hbs | 15 +- 109 files changed, 4263 insertions(+), 1463 deletions(-) ----------------------------------------------------------------------